Discover the life of Fred Rogers--a story about helping others for kids ages 6 to 9

Fred Rogers created one of the longest-running children's TV shows ever, Mister Rogers' Neighborhood. Before he became famous for his puppetry and storytelling, Fred was a shy kid who couldn't play outside because of his allergies. He found a passion for puppets, which he used to start his own TV show as an adult.

On his show, Fred helped kids make sense of both serious and silly things, talk about their feelings, and feel loved. Explore how Fred Rogers went from a young boy growing up in Pennsylvania to an award-winning TV show host and beloved role model.

About the Author
Katz, Susan B.: -

SUSAN B. KATZ is a National Board-Certified Teacher, educational consultant, and author of more than five books, including The Story of Jane Goodall, The Story of Albert Einstein, and The Story of Ruth Bader Ginsburg. Visit her online at SusanKatzBooks.com.
